bmcm introduces isolated differential amplifiers in miniature format 0

Maisach/Munich/Germany. The highly compact isolation amplifiers of the MAL-ISO series from BMC Messsysteme GmbH (bmcm) provide a cost-efficient solution for measuring voltage signals or current without interferences.

Volvo Car Corporation signs agreement with PC-WARE 0

With the divestment from Ford, Volvo Car Corporation signs an agreement with PC-WARE for the central management and purchasing of software licenses. The agreement covers the worldwide software provision and management for the entire Volvo Car Corporation.
